I just installed my old printer, HP 610C, which works
fine, to my computer and everything in the set-up went
smooth. But, upon trying to print the test page, or
anything else for that matter, the "no paper" light on
the printer comes on and Windows XP says that the
document is canceled. Any advice?

Generally this is to do with the hardware inside the printer and is not
something that can be fixed by you or us... it's a job for a specialist. It
involves whatever sensor is inside the printer that 'sees' if paper is in
the tray or not.

Since it's such an old printer, I'd suggest replacing it would be cheaper.
